In this paper, variable precision rough set theory is introduced to logistics center location problem. Firstly, an index system is built for logistics center location. Secondly, a discretization method for continuous decision table is put forward. In this method, some crisp ldquocutsrdquo are got based on information entropy, and then to be carried out fuzzy operation. In both crisp discrete intervals and fuzzy discrete intervals, the crisp ldquocut intervalsrdquo are more important than the single ldquocutsrdquo. Thirdly, information entropy is introduced to the attributes reduction process of rough set. And then the improved attributes reduction way is used to elaborate the knowledge discovery of logistics center location from the index system. Finally, the rules mined from decision table can be used to instruct the decision support system for logistics center location.
